With 12 miles of beachfront, Hilton Head is a popular vacation destination for over two million tourists each year. In addition to the beaches, a variety of activities are available for families, ranging from museums to restaurants to miniature golf.
Outdoor Activities

Kids can search for shells and build sandcastles on Hilton Head's Atlantic-front beaches. The whole family can look for wildlife at Pinckney Island Nature Preserve. Area golf courses offer opportunities for parents and kids alike to play 18 holes. Golf academies also hold summer camps to teach kids how to play.

Dining

Hilton Head has over 250 restaurants, many of which have patios for outdoor dining. Try the local seafood, or choose one of many other types of cuisine, such as Mexican, Thai, Japanese, Greek and French.

Museums

Several of Hilton Head's museums offer family activities. The Coastal Discovery Museum has exhibits and activities that provide information about Hilton Head Island and other sea islands. The museum also offers 11 different cruises and tours around the island. The Sandbox is an interactive museum specifically designed for children. The hands-on exhibits help children learn and have fun.

Activities

For a small admission fee, families can climb to the top of the Harbour Town Lighthouse in Sea Pines and view the island's south end. Other activities in Sea Pines include shopping, restaurants and horseback riding. Play a round or two of miniature golf, or step inside Island Playground. This indoor playground has inflatable slides and obstacle courses as well as a dress-up area and castle. An annual St. Patrick's Day Parade is held every March and attracts thousands of spectators.

Entertainment

See a play at the Arts Center of Coastal Carolina, or catch a concert by the Hilton Head Symphony Orchestra. Various arts camps are also available at the Arts Center. If your kids aren't into the arts, catch a film at one of the three movie theaters in town.
